Power and Performance
When it comes to performance, the BLACK+DECKER Jig Saw boasts a powerful 4.5 Amp motor that can generate up to 3,000 strokes per minute (spm). In contrast, the BLACK+DECKER 20V MAX* POWERCONNECT Cordless Jig Saw features a variable-speed trigger capable of cutting up to 2,500 revolutions per minute (rpm). Although the Jig Saw delivers a higher cutting speed, the Cordless Jig Saw's versatility in cutting various materials gives it an edge in performance for detailed applications. Thus, the choice may depend on whether you prioritize max power or versatility.
Portability and Convenience
The BLACK+DECKER 20V MAX* POWERCONNECT Cordless Jig Saw is designed for mobility, allowing users to work without the constraints of a power cord. This cordless feature is particularly advantageous for outdoor projects or locations without easy access to electrical outlets. On the other hand, the BLACK+DECKER Jig Saw, being corded, offers unlimited runtime, making it suitable for extended tasks. Therefore, if you frequently work in different locations, the Cordless Jig Saw may be more convenient, while the Jig Saw excels in consistent power for longer projects.
Features and Usability
Both jigsaws incorporate user-friendly features, but they cater to slightly different needs. The BLACK+DECKER Jig Saw includes a quick-clamp system for tool-free blade changes, making it easy to switch tasks. It also has a built-in dust blower to keep your workspace clear. Conversely, the BLACK+DECKER 20V MAX* POWERCONNECT Cordless Jig Saw offers a variable-speed trigger for enhanced control and a bevel shoe for angled cuts, along with a wire guard for precision cutting. These features suggest that while both tools are user-friendly, the Cordless Jig Saw may be better for intricate work.
